Vanadi Coffee’s Bold Shift Toward Bitcoin

In a groundbreaking announcement, Vanadi Coffee's Chairman Salvador Martí confirmed the company’s intent to become a Bitcoin-focused organization, pivoting away from its traditional business model rooted in the food and beverage industry.

The company’s leadership is set to propose a major shift in capital allocation during its upcoming board meeting on June 29, 2025. Martí will seek authorization to implement a Bitcoin acquisition strategy that would begin with the issuance of convertible bonds—a financial instrument aimed at raising the necessary capital for their Bitcoin reserve.

The move aligns with the strategy used by major Bitcoin-adopting corporations, which have financed large-scale BTC purchases through stock offerings, debt instruments, or other innovative capital-raising mechanisms.

Vanadi’s Bitcoin Strategy Mirrors MicroStrategy's Playbook

Vanadi’s proposed investment echoes the aggressive Bitcoin-buying tactics of MicroStrategy, the U.S.-based software firm that was one of the earliest public companies to integrate Bitcoin into its corporate treasury strategy.

Just as MicroStrategy's bold moves earned it significant media coverage and investor interest, Vanadi Coffee hopes to transform its public image and financial structure, leveraging Bitcoin to differentiate itself in a competitive market.

Martí has stated his intent to issue convertible bonds as a way to create a Bitcoin reserve fund, a model that has proven successful for firms aiming to avoid the dilution of traditional stock issuance while securing sufficient capital.
